#909667 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#909667 is composed of 56.5% red, 58.8%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.3%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 67.7 degrees, a saturation of 18.6% and a lightness of 49.6%. #909667 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ffce with #212d00.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

#909667 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#909667 has RGB values of R:144, G:150, B:103 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0, Y:0.31,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9475687.
